Today, as Christians worldwide celebrate the resurrection of Jesus Christ, members of the First Presbyterian Church of DeBary will celebrate Easter with the resurrection of their sanctuary from the ashes of a fire in August 2009.”Easter is a time for renewal, the beginning of spring; the flowers grow again; the trees grow back their leaves. It’s the same with the church building,” said Tori Fox, a church member for 27 years.
With that sense of renewal comes the sense that, for a congregation that has been around since the 1950s, everything is new again. There was the first Sunday service, the first wedding, the first funeral, the first Christmas and now the first Easter.
“Every time is the first, so it’s very exciting,” said Janet Clark, a member for 38 years.
